Output 23046596f8564fadab480e95d2a4251904afa0dee6f6164e7fb0c6af6a497fa6:0
- value
- 31898939
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bef45743a42ae33d5eb93d8392b48b9dc2c21ad OP_EQUAL
- address
- 3Qf8AZ8vXjhfWzmDx6PdLsXXPnjiHYKR3X
- transaction
- 23046596f8564fadab480e95d2a4251904afa0dee6f6164e7fb0c6af6a497fa6
- confirmations
- 452808
- spent
- true